Calories in Moderation: A Key to Healthy Consumption

It is important to note that the calorie content in White Zinfandel can vary depending on various factors. The alcohol content, residual sugar, and serving size all play a role in determining the overall calorie count of this delectable wine.

While exact figures may differ between brands and specific variations, a standard serving of White Zinfandel typically contains around 121-130 calories. However, it is crucial to enjoy this delightful wine in moderation, as excessive consumption can contribute to an increased calorie intake, leading to potential health concerns.

Grape Ripeness and Sugar Levels

One of the key factors influencing the calorie content in White Zinfandel is the ripeness of the grapes used in its production. Ripe grapes tend to have higher sugar levels, which can contribute to a higher calorie count. As the grapes mature, their sugar content increases, resulting in a naturally sweeter taste and potentially more calories. Selecting grapes at a specific level of ripeness can help control the overall calorie content of the final product.

Fermentation and Alcohol Content

The fermentation process plays a significant role in determining the calorie content of White Zinfandel. When the sugars in the grapes are converted into alcohol through fermentation, the calorie count decreases. Higher alcohol content in the wine indicates that more sugar has been fermented, resulting in a lower calorie content. On the other hand, White Zinfandels with lower alcohol content may retain a higher amount of residual sugar, contributing to a slightly higher calorie count. Controlling the fermentation process can help achieve the desired calorie content in the final product.

Exploring Red Wines

Red wines, such as Cabernet Sauvignon and Merlot, are known for their bold flavors and rich textures. These wines often exhibit strong notes of dark berries, chocolate, and spices, providing a complex and robust drinking experience. In comparison, white zinfandel offers a lighter body and a more fruit-forward flavor profile.

Contrasting White Wines

White wines, like Chardonnay and Sauvignon Blanc, offer a crisp and refreshing taste with varying levels of acidity. Chardonnay, known for its buttery and creamy texture, presents a different experience than the fruit-forward sweetness of white zinfandel. Sauvignon Blanc, on the other hand, offers a bright and zesty flavor with herbal undertones.

Choosing the Perfect Pairings

When it comes to food pairings, the characteristics of different wine varieties play a crucial role. White zinfandel is often enjoyed with lighter dishes, such as salads, seafood, or poultry, due to its fruity and refreshing nature. In contrast, red wines tend to complement heartier meals like red meat, game, or robust cheeses. White wines, with their acidity and crispness, pair well with seafood, white meats, and lighter pasta dishes.
